liunx系统支持什么编程语言
-
Linux系统支持众多编程语言,以满足不同开发需求。下面是一些常见的编程语言在Linux上的支持情况:
-
C语言:Linux系统的内核就是用C语言编写的,因此Linux对于C语言的支持是非常完善的。通过GCC(GNU Compiler Collection)编译器,开发者可以在Linux上编写高效、可靠的C语言程序。
-
C++语言:C++是C语言的扩展,也被广泛地使用于Linux开发环境。GCC编译器同样支持C++,可以进行面向对象的程序设计和开发。
-
Java语言:Java是一种广泛应用的跨平台编程语言,也可以在Linux上进行开发。在Linux下,可以使用OpenJDK或Oracle JDK等来编写和运行Java程序。
-
Python语言:Python是一种易学易用且功能强大的脚本语言,广泛应用于Web开发、数据分析、人工智能等领域。Linux通常预装了Python解释器,可以直接使用。
-
Ruby语言:Ruby是一种简洁、优雅的脚本语言,适用于Web应用开发和系统管理。Linux上有Ruby的解释器可用,如MRI(Matz's Ruby Interpreter)和JRuby。
-
Perl语言:Perl是一种高级脚本语言,主要应用于文本处理、系统管理和网络编程。Linux上通常会预装Perl解释器。
-
Shell脚本:Shell脚本是Linux系统中执行命令和操作的脚本语言,是一种通用的脚本语言。常见的Linux发行版都会提供Bash(Bourne Again SHell)作为默认的Shell解释器。
除了以上的编程语言,Linux还支持其他诸如Go语言、Swift语言、Rust语言等现代化的编程语言。此外,对于某些特定的开发需求,Linux还提供了广泛的开发工具和库,以便开发者充分利用系统和硬件资源。
总之,Linux作为开放且自由的操作系统,具有广泛的编程语言支持,可以满足不同类型的开发需求。开发者可以根据自己的需求选择合适的编程语言进行开发。
1年前 -
-
Linux系统是一个开源的操作系统,可以支持多种编程语言。下面是一些常见的编程语言在Linux系统上的支持情况:
-
C语言:Linux系统最早是用C语言开发的,因此对C语言的支持非常好。几乎所有的Linux发行版都自带了C语言编译器(例如gcc),并且还有很多C语言的开发工具和库可以使用。
-
C++语言:C++是C语言的扩展,也受到了Linux系统的广泛支持。Linux系统同样配备了C++的编译器(例如g++),并且有丰富的C++开发工具和库供开发者使用。
-
Python语言:Python是一种简单易用的高级编程语言,也是Linux系统中非常受欢迎的一种语言。几乎所有的Linux发行版都自带了Python解释器,用户可以直接在终端中运行Python程序。此外,Linux系统中还有许多Python开发工具和库,用于快速开发各种应用程序。
-
Java语言:Java是一种跨平台的高级编程语言,也可以在Linux系统上运行。在Linux系统中,可以使用OpenJDK或者Oracle JDK来编译和运行Java程序,并且有众多的Java开发工具和库可以使用。
-
PHP语言:PHP是一种用于Web开发的脚本语言,同样可以在Linux系统上运行。Linux系统中提供了Apache、Nginx等常用的Web服务器,配合PHP解释器,可以进行Web应用的开发和部署。
除了上述几种编程语言外,Linux系统还支持许多其他的编程语言,例如Perl、Ruby、Go、Rust等。在Linux系统上,开发者可以根据自己的需求选择合适的编程语言,并利用丰富的开发工具和库进行程序开发。
1年前 -
-
Linux系统支持多种编程语言,下面将逐一介绍一些主要的编程语言及其在Linux系统上的支持情况。
-
C语言
C语言是一种通用的程序设计语言,广泛用于系统编程,Linux内核就是用C语言编写的。在Linux系统上,C语言的开发工具包包括GNU C Compiler (GCC),这是一个功能强大的编译器集合,可以编译C代码以生成可执行文件。 -
C++语言
C++是基于C语言的扩展,支持面向对象编程。在Linux系统上,同样可以使用GCC来编译C++代码。此外,还有一些其他的C++编译器可供选择,例如Clang/LLVM。 -
Python语言
Python是一种高级的、动态的、面向对象的编程语言。在Linux系统中,Python通常是默认安装的,几乎所有的Linux发行版都提供了Python的解释器。可以使用文本编辑器编写Python代码,并通过终端执行。另外,也可以使用各种集成开发环境(IDE)来进行Python编程。 -
Java语言
Java是一种跨平台的高级编程语言,可以在Linux上编写和运行Java程序。在Linux系统中,必须安装Java Development Kit (JDK)来编写和构建Java程序。一般情况下,可以使用OpenJDK或者Oracle JDK来进行Java开发。 -
Ruby语言
Ruby是一种动态的、面向对象的编程语言,具有简单易读的语法。在Linux系统中,Ruby通常也是默认安装的。可以使用文本编辑器编写Ruby代码,并通过终端执行。另外,也可以使用各种集成开发环境(IDE)来进行Ruby编程。 -
Perl语言
Perl是一种通用的脚本语言,广泛用于文本处理和系统管理等领域。在Linux系统中,Perl通常也是默认安装的。可以使用文本编辑器编写Perl代码,并通过终端执行。
除了以上这些主要的编程语言,Linux还支持很多其他的编程语言,比如Go语言、Rust语言、Swift语言等。可以根据实际需求选择适合的编程语言进行开发。
1年前 -